Global Procurement Specialist- Capital Equipment and Construction
$107,600–$147,950 year
RemoteUnited States
Job Summary
Develop and implement global procurement strategies for Capital Equipment and Construction categories to ensure business continuity and value creation. Establish and manage supplier relationships to secure cost and service benefits, while negotiating and establishing effective contract agreements that hold suppliers accountable for competitive pricing, quality, and service levels. Collaborate with internal stakeholders to prioritize activities for the successful integration of procurement strategies and processes, and lead complex, high-value initiatives with broad corporate implications. This role supports Solventum's mission to enable better, smarter, safer healthcare through breakthrough solutions at the intersection of health, material, and data science.
